dc.description.abstract | A diaryl isoxazole compound, KRIBB3, which exhibits strong antimigratory and antimitotic activities against cancer cells, was prepared in a practical synthetic way. The synthetic method may provide easy access to KRIBB3 analogs with various substituents at an aryl moiety for structure-activity relationships (SAR), as well as a large quantity of KRIBB3 for in vivo studies. | - |
